Pearson is offering a part-time role in Glasgow, Scotland, focused on providing excellent customer service in a testing environment. The position requires processing test candidates, administering tests, and ensuring compliance with operational standards.
Ideal candidates should have experience with Microsoft Office and be flexible with scheduling.
Benefits include a pension scheme, healthcare options, and gym membership discounts, reflecting Pearson's commitment to employee diversity and wellbeing.
